Natural Buffer Systems In The Human Body . Acidic buffer solutions and alkaline buffer solutions. The buffer systems functioning in blood plasma include plasma proteins, phosphate, and bicarbonate and carbonic acid buffers. The body uses buffer systems to reduce the impact of an acute acid load.
